Simply put, a jointer flattens a face or straightens an edge while a planer adjusts the thickness of the wood. you may need one or the other, or possibly both to complete your project. understanding how they work and what they require is crucial in choosing which one is needed for your project.

A jointer flattens a woodworking planer vs jointer face or straightens and squares an edge, and a planer thicknesses wood. whether you need one, the other, or both can easily be answered by knowing how they work, what they do, and how much wood surface preparation you pay your lumberyard to do for you.

The primary difference between jointer and planer tools is that a jointer shores up the edges on a piece of wood while a planer removes a portion of the thickness from that wood. using a combo tool helps you create boards and sheets that are perfectly smooth as well as even and level. A jointer is a woodworking power tool for flattening a wood along its length. it’s used for making one face of a lumber or board flat. it’s used together with a thickness planer for dimensioning rough lumber so they can be flat and square.
